PUVINoise vs Helicone

Helicone focuses on LLM gateway observability, cost, and request analytics. PUVINoise focuses on agent behaviour runtime, intent, and governed recovery across fleets.

Fair framing

This page positions categories honestly. Helicone is strong at llm observability & gateway. PUVINoise is Behaviour Runtime Intelligence for AI agent fleets — observe behaviour, understand intent, predict outcomes, and recover with governance. Many teams use both.

Focus

What each is optimized for

Helicone

LLM proxy/gateway observability — latency, cost, request logging, and analytics for model API usage.

PUVINoise

End-to-end agent behaviour: decisions, tools, sessions, Command Centre, and recovery — not only model request metrics.

Choose Helicone when

Your main pain is LLM API cost, latency, and request logging
You want a gateway/proxy observability layer in front of model providers
Agent orchestration recovery is out of scope for now

Choose PUVINoise when

Failures live in tool selection, intent drift, and multi-step agent paths
You need Runtime Cases tied to behaviour signals, not only request logs
Multi-tenant fleets need governed remediation
